Transaction 74e3957335c8e6fcde0895295cdfa525c583f2dce118ed6cccbc2a63ac78273c
1 Input
1 Output
-
74e3957335c8e6fcde0895295cdfa525c583f2dce118ed6cccbc2a63ac78273c:0
- value
- 987262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 501e9f88c7ac137a9cb6b4117eb7dcdc0e93f286 OP_EQUAL
- address
- 38zefdGSB2A1qpsQksomqdKrhaK9ngKbC5